Large-scale implementations present new challenges that require customized implementations.
Achieve3000 has a unique approach to district-wide implementations:
- Meet with district administration to develop a customized professional service plan.
- Prepare instructional leaders through our Principal Awareness Session that focuses on program benefits and keys to successful implementation.
- Provide implementation reviews with district administrators at three critical points starting at the
beginning to assure timely program launch and forward movement. At mid-year, progress is measured in terms of usage and performance. The year-end review evaluates success and lessons learned.

Implementation Review
This three-part session for district administrators assures that problems are solved early and that necessary resources and interventions are readily available. The reviews occur at critical implementation
points. The first session takes place shortly after implementation begins, to make sure that the solutions are
up and running and in use. The second takes place mid-year, to evaluate implementation progress and measure usage according to goals. The final session takes place after the school year is over, to evaluate the success of the implementation and to begin planning for next year.
